Master\u2019s Degree in Optometry \u2013 Two to Three Year Duration
\nThe Master\u2019s Degree in Optometry is an academic degree, not a professional one. It is not specifically targeted at students who wish to practise in the field as a Doctor of Optometry. Individuals who pursue this graduate degree typically are interested in optometry work in the areas of research, administration, and teaching. It is important to note, therefore, that a Master\u2019s Degree in Optometry is not required to begin doctoral studies in optometry.

Doctoral Degree in Optometry \u2013 Four to Five Year Duration
\nAfter passing the Optometry Admission Test (OAT) and being accepted into an accredited optometry program, students can start the four year process of earning their Doctor of Optometry Degree and becoming licensed to practise.

\n

Optometry doctoral programs are made up of classroom lectures combined with hands-on clinical training. Students may choose to concentrate their studies in an optometry specialization, such as ocular disease or geriatric optometry.

Optician
\nOptician programs train students to fabricate and fit vision aids according the prescription of an optometrist or ophthalmologist.

\n

Orthoptics
\nOrthoptics programs teach students how to diagnose, and manage eye conditions that affect eye movement and visual development. These conditions include strabismus (misalignment of the eyes/squinting) and amblyopia (lazy eye).

\n

Pre-Medicine (Pre-Med)
\nPre-med programs, designed to prepare students for medical school, include courses in general biology, molecular biology, biochemistry, and physics.

There are also non-clinical roles for optometry graduates, some of which may require additional training:

\n

Freelance writing \u2013 writing about the optometry field

\n

Healthcare administration \u2013 this role generally requires experience working in healthcare systems

\n

Healthcare IT consulting \u2013 opportunities in this field are expanding as electronic health records become common

\n

Optometry practice management consulting \u2013 helping practice owners with the business aspects optometry

\n

Recruiting \u2013 working for a medical recruiting firm, specializing in finding qualified optometrists for open positions

\n

Research and development \u2013 vision science research opportunities may exist with pharmaceutical companies

\n

Teaching \u2013 working as a professor of optometry or as a supervisor of optometrist trainees

什么是视光学位?

验光学位课程教授学生如何诊断、治疗和纠正视力问题。课程汇集了视觉科学、光学、生物学、疾病、遗传学和生理学的主题。

验光学位课程的毕业生通常会成为验光师.他们经过培训,有资格:

  • 进行眼部检查
  • 执行各种视力测试并分析测试结果
  • 诊断和治疗眼部缺陷和疾病
  • 配戴矫正镜
  • 识别其他健康问题的眼部指标,如高血压、糖尿病、关节炎、甲状腺疾病、肿瘤和癌症

程序选项

视光学士学位-三至四年学制
一般来说,进入视光学院需要学士学位。有些学校提供特定的课程视光学士学位.这些专业的课程包括以下内容:

  • 人眼解剖学
  • 眼睛状况、问题和疾病
  • 视力问题的矫正治疗

大多数拥有这个学位的毕业生会继续获得成为验光师所需的博士学位。那些不选择继续接受正规教育的人可以在验光室和诊所找到助理或技术人员的工作。

视光学硕士学位-两至三年
验光硕士学位是学术学位,不是专业学位。它不是专门针对希望在视光博士领域实习的学生。追求这个研究生学位的个人通常对研究、管理和教学领域的验光工作感兴趣。重要的是要注意,因此,在验光硕士学位要求开始验光学博士学习。

一些学校同时提供硕士/博士学位。

视光学博士学位——四至五年学制
在通过视光学入学考试(OAT)并被认可的视光学课程录取后,学生可以开始为期四年的攻读视光学博士学位的过程,并获得执业执照。

视光学博士课程由课堂授课与实际临床培训相结合组成。学生可选择视光专业,如眼科疾病或老年视光专业。

学位类似于验光

眼科学
眼科学是研究眼睛的解剖、功能和疾病的医学分支。该领域的学位课程使学生成为专门从事眼睛医学和外科护理的医生。

眼科技师
接受眼科实验室技术员培训的学生学习如何制作眼镜和隐形眼镜。他们还学习物理和数学,以及这些学科在工作中的应用。

眼科技术
眼科技术是另一门专注于眼部护理的学科。该领域的学位课程教授学生作为眼科医生助理工作所需的技能。课程内容包括眼科检查,眼科疾病和缺陷的诊断,以及正确使用眼科检测设备。

眼镜商
验光师课程训练学生根据验光师或眼科医生的处方制作和安装视力辅助设备。

视轴矫正法
矫形光学课程教授学生如何诊断和管理影响眼球运动和视觉发育的眼部疾病。这些条件包括斜视(眼睛不对准/斜视)和弱视(弱视)。

Pre-Medicine(医学预科)
医学预科课程旨在为学生进入医学院做准备,课程包括普通生物学、分子生物学、生物化学和物理学。

你有验光学位能做什么?

大多数验光师毕业生都在工作临床实践.他们可能受雇于:

独立的验光-私人执业
企业验光-与大型公司合作,包括光学/视觉零售连锁店和眼部护理商店
医院验光-在医院工作,治疗需要紧急护理的病人

也有非临床角色视光专业毕业生(部分可能需要额外训练):

自由写作-关于视光领域的写作

医疗管理-该职位通常需要在医疗保健系统工作经验

医疗保健IT咨询-随着电子健康记录的普及,这一领域的机会正在扩大

验光实践管理咨询-协助执业业主进行验光业务方面的工作

招聘-在一家医疗招聘公司工作,专门为空缺职位寻找合格的验光师

研发-视觉科学研究机会可能存在与制药公司

教学-担任视光学教授或视光师见习导师
